Assuming that you mean a 12 feet diameter circular pool to a depth of 1 foot...
the volume would be 'pi' r2 x 1ft = 3.142 x 6 x 6 x 1 = 113.112 ft3
which is 704.556 gallons (UK) x 4.54609 = 3,202.974986 litres In other words, approximately 3,200 litres.
It depends on how high you would like to fill it. You see, a liter is a 3-dimensional measure of volume (like a cubic foot is), and a square foot is a 2-dimensional measure of area. So, for example, to fill an area of 10,500 square feet to a height of 1 foot, you would need 297,326.889 liters.
There are 28.3168 liters in 1 cubic foot. A cubic foot is used to measure the volume of a substance.
